Output 89f0943fce2b6d57b8c6c60e26d1220b765c6808519ec48a08ac1058a41f251e:0

value
325578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8b6fd5adc3170e53d29245080ab0d75c3a0859 OP_EQUAL
address
34PEZMDM2tpQuPCQTPRfhbivEvqeed6vBA
transaction
89f0943fce2b6d57b8c6c60e26d1220b765c6808519ec48a08ac1058a41f251e
spent
true